This is just a brief posting to inform you about recent ongoing research that is looking into the potential for certain enzymes in the body to cause conditions of anxiety to occur. We have identified two such enzymes, glyoxalase-1 and glutathione reductase-1, that when manipulated, are capable of inducing high states of anxiety in animal models under study.

This is actually very good news because it may provide us with a direction to proceed in preventing anxiety from occurring rather than attenuating its after-effects with medication. You can visit the following link to learn more:
